Digby Fairweather
Meet Digby Fairweather, the jazzy, snazzy trumpet player with a smile as big as his talent. Hailing from the UK, this musical maestro has been gracing stages with his smooth sounds and slick style for over four decades.
Fairweather first picked up a trumpet at the age of 15 and hasn't looked back since. With a career that has seen him perform alongside legends such as George Melly and Stan Tracey, it's clear that Digby has earned his stripes in the jazz world.
Known for his charismatic stage presence and impeccable improvisational skills, Fairweather is a true showman who knows how to captivate an audience. Whether he's belting out a classic jazz standard or putting his own spin on a modern tune, Digby never fails to impress.
But it's not just his musical talents that make him stand out - Fairweather is also a renowned jazz historian and broadcaster, with a deep knowledge and passion for the genre that shines through in everything he does.
